/* Normal desktop :1200px. */
@media (min-width: 1200px) and (max-width: 1500px) {
    .main-menu ul li a{
        font-size: 16px;
    }
    .ht_btn{
        font-size: 14px;
        padding: 20px 10px;
    }
    .search-area{
        display: none !important;
    }
}

/* Normal desktop :992px. */
@media (min-width: 992px) and (max-width: 1200px) {

.search-area{
    display: none !important;
}
.main-menu ul li a{
    font-size: 16px;
}
.ht_btn{
    font-size: 14px;
    padding: 20px 10px;
}
}

/* Tablet desktop :768px. */
@media (min-width: 768px) and (max-width: 991px) {
    .mean-container .mean-nav ul li a{
        font-size: 14px;
    }
    .mean-container .mean-nav ul li a i{
        display: none;
    }
    .page-title.project.mb-10{
        font-size: 32px;
    }
    .search-area{
    display: none !important;
}
}

/* small mobile :320px. */
@media (max-width: 767px) {
    .mean-container .mean-nav ul li a{
        font-size: 14px;
    }
    .mean-container .mean-nav ul li a i{
        display: none;
    }
    .page-title.project.mb-10{
        font-size: 30px;
    }
    .search-area{
        display: none !important;
    }
}

/* Large Mobile :480px. */
@media only screen and (min-width: 480px) and (max-width: 767px) {
    .container {
        width: 450px;
    }
    .mean-container .mean-nav ul li a{
        font-size: 14px;
    }
    .page-title.project.mb-10{
        font-size: 30px;
    }
    .search-area{
        display: none !important;
    }
}
